Details of the Lawsuit
The lawsuit is centered around allegations of unlawful detention and inhumane treatment during the flight. The plaintiffs argue that the airline violated their rights by allowing authorities to board the plane and detain them without proper justification. The details are intricate, with each man recounting his personal experience, which includes:
- Forced Confinement: Many reported being confined to a section of the plane, feeling like prisoners rather than passengers.
- Lack of Communication: They were not informed about the reasons for their detainment, leaving them in a state of confusion and fear.
- Physical and Emotional Distress: The entire ordeal caused significant psychological trauma, which the lawsuit aims to address.
As the case unfolds, itโs becoming clear that these allegations are not just about individual experiences but also about systemic issues within airline operations and their cooperation with government authorities.

Legal Aspects to Consider
From a legal standpoint, the case is complex. It involves various aspects of international law, human rights legislation, and airline regulations. Here are some key legal considerations:
- International Treaties: The plaintiffs may invoke international human rights treaties that protect individuals from unlawful detention.
- Jurisdiction Issues: Determining where the lawsuit should be filed can complicate matters, especially given the international nature of air travel.
- Potential Defenses: The airline may argue that they were acting under the authority of law enforcement, which could complicate the case.
Understanding these legal intricacies is crucial for anyone following the case, as they will play a significant role in the outcome.
